This province has a GDP of R420,647 million and it is inhabited by about 10 million people and counting. 5. … NettetAnswer: Cebu is the oldest Philippine city because it is the oldest Spanish settlement in the country. In 1521, Ferdinand Magellan and his crew of Spanish explorers landed at the island of Cebu and claimed it for the Spanish crown. It was the first Spanish settlement in the Philippines and the first step in the Spanish conquest of the country.

NettetIn 1910 four of the colonies were brought together as the Union of South Africa. Nettet3. feb. 2024 · Yep, the inhabitants of Kili Island, which is just 0.36 square miles, live there because the United States government used their original home as a nuclear test site.
